Start with a Site Visit and Quote
Engage an experienced staircase designer early in the process. Many companies provide free site visits and quotes, giving you an idea of the budget required for your desired staircase. Advanced 3D software is often used to visualize designs, allowing you to see how various features affect costs. This ensures accurate quotes and helps refine your vision from day one.
Choose the Right Materials
Material selection significantly impacts the overall budget. A traditional straight timber staircase will cost less than a bespoke spiral staircase with intricate metalwork. Discuss material options with your designer to find a balance between aesthetics and affordability. Bring along images or inspiration to concept meetings to ensure the design reflects your style.
Factor in Demolition Costs
If you’re renovating and replacing an existing staircase, don’t overlook demolition costs. Including these in your budget will give you a realistic picture of the overall project expenditure.
Optimize the Design for Your Space
A professional staircase architect can enhance your staircase’s design to suit your home and budget. For example, floating cantilever stairs reduce material usage while maintaining a sleek, modern look. Experiment with different shapes and layouts to discover cost-saving adjustments without compromising the final design. You might also consider standard designs instead of fully bespoke options.
